Output 968406968614076d69a4a94c7be5e3673795bb55ada11280a48ffcd38720c420:3

value
2531125
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37e28d209a751a4149ea62859e85e31a60ad3b20 OP_EQUAL
address
36nWV9qjELyNi7hhnChpj4besoiGiMn2U6
transaction
968406968614076d69a4a94c7be5e3673795bb55ada11280a48ffcd38720c420
confirmations
237537
spent
true